232: Linux 6.5, Valve Proton, Future of Ubuntu, CIQ Sued & more Linux news!

Welcome to This Week in Linux (232). This episode is jam-packed with stuff. It’s actually kind of ridiculous how much there’s in this episode. So we’re gonna talk about the Linux kernel itself with 6.5 being released. Also, we’re gonna celebrate some birthdays / anniversaries for Valve’s Proton and Bugzilla. And then we’re gonna be talking about the future of the Ubuntu desktop, as well as the Enterprise Linux drama is back and this time, not for Red Hat though. We’re gonna be talking about CIQ slash Rocky Linux, Also, we’ve got some distro releases and some more app news. All of this and more on this episode of This Week in Linux, Your Source for Linux GNews!
